Unit4AmazingPlantsandAnimals

Lesson1

I.

Teaching

Objectives:

By

the

end

of

this

lesson,

students

will

be

able

to:

1.

identify

and

listen

for

key

information

(names

of

plants/animals,

superlatives)

in

conversations;

2.

describe

amazing

plants

and

animals

using

adjectives

and

superlatives;

3.

express

personal

preferences

about

plants/animals

and

explain

why.

II.

Key

Points

&

Difficulties

Key

Points:

1.

Students

will

improve

listening

skills

by

extracting

key

details

from

dialogues.

2.

Students

will

learn

and

practice

using

superlatives

to

describe

plants

and

animals.

Difficulties:

1.

Some

students

may

struggle

with

listeningforkeyinformation.

2.

Students

might

find

it

challenging

to

use

superlatives

naturally

in

spoken

conversations.

III.

Teaching

Methods

1.

TaskBased

Learning.

2.

municative

Approach.

3.AudioLingual

Method.

Teaching

Aids:CAI

V.

Teaching

Procedures

Step

1:

Warmup

Studentslookatthepicturesin1aandanswer:

What

do

you

see?

Which

one

is

the

tallest/fastest?

Step

2:

PreListening

Activity

1:Studentsfinish1a.

Activity

2:

Students

match

adjectives

(big,

old,

fast)

to

the

plants/animals

in

1a.

Example:

The

blue

whale

is

the

heaviest.

The

cheetah

is

the

fastest.

Step

3:

WhileListening

Task

1

(1b):Listen

and

number

the

plants/animals

in

order.

Task

2

(1c):Listen

again

and

match

superlatives

(AF)

to

the

plants/

animals.

Step

4:

PostListening

Pair

Work

(1d):

Ask/answer

questions

using

superlatives.

What’s

amazing

about

the

cheetah?

It’s

the

fastest

animal.

Extension:

Students

add

their

own

examples

The

panda

is

the

cutest.

Step

5:

Speaking

Practice

RolePlay:

In

pairs,

students

act

as

"tour

guides"

describing

amazing

plants/animals.

Wele

to

the

forest!

This

redwood

tree

is

the

tallest

in

the

world!

Feedback:

Teacher

corrects

pronunciation/grammar

mistakes.
